General circuit sequence of a distribution box

A distribution box receives power through a main switch, passes it through protective devices like MCBs and RCCBs, and then distributes it to individual circuits via outgoing lines.

Overview of a Distribution Box

A distribution box (DB box) is the central hub for electrical power in a building, distributing electricity safely from a single input source to multiple circuits . It houses key components such as the main circuit breaker, residual current circuit breakers (RCCBs), miniature circuit breakers (MCBs), bus bars, neutral links, and earth links . The box ensures protection against overloads, short circuits, and electrical shocks.

Typical Circuit Sequence

  1. Incoming Power Supply: The main phase and neutral wires from the utility or main substation enter the distribution box. This is often connected to a main MCB or main switch, which controls the overall power supply to the DB .
  2. Main Protective Device: The main MCB acts as the first line of protection, handling the highest current rating in the system. In single-phase domestic setups, this is usually a double-pole MCB rated around 63A .
  3. Residual Current Device (RCCB): The output from the main MCB is connected to an RCCB, which protects against leakage currents and electric shocks. The RCCB ensures that any imbalance between live and neutral currents triggers a disconnection, typically rated at 30mA for domestic installations .
  4. Bus Bars and Neutral Link: After the RCCB, power is distributed to bus bars—metal strips that act as central connection points for all outgoing circuits. The neutral link distributes the neutral wire to each circuit, while the earth link connects all protective grounding wires .
  5. Outgoing Circuits via MCBs: Individual circuits are connected to single-pole or double-pole MCBs depending on the load type. Each MCB protects a specific load, such as lighting, sockets, or heavy appliances. The MCBs are connected to the bus bars for phase supply and to the neutral link for return current .
  6. Optional Dual Power or Smart Modules: Some distribution boxes include a dual power switch for backup supply or smart modules for energy monitoring and remote control. These are integrated after the main protective devices and before the outgoing circuits .

Summary

The general sequence in a distribution box can be summarized as: Incoming supply → Main MCB → RCCB → Bus bars / Neutral / Earth links → Outgoing MCBs → Load circuits This sequence ensures that all circuits are protected, organized, and safely powered. Proper installation and labeling of each component are essential for maintenance, troubleshooting, and safety .
